339. Deputy Paul McAuliffe asked the Minister for Housing, Local Government and Heritage the breakdown of Urban Regeneration and Development Fund funding for each Dublin local authority for the past two years;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[9192/22]

View answer

Written answers

The Urban Regeneration and Development Fund (URDF) was launched in 2018 under the National Development plan 2018-2027 to support more compact and sustainable development in accordance with the objectives of the National Planning Framework.

To date there have been two calls for proposals under the URDF, the first in July 2018 and the second in January 2020. The table below gives the approved provisional URDF funding allocations for projects approved for each of the Dublin local authorities under both calls.

Applicant

Provisional Allocation Call 1 €

Provisional Allocation Call 2 €

Total Provisional Allocation €

Dublin City Council

17,837,007

174,300,554

192,137,561

Dún Laoghaire Rathdown County Council

21,465,098

44,361,115

65,826,213

Fingal County Council

2,500,000

25,480,125

27,980,125

South Dublin County Council

32,464,278

186,323,057

218,787,335
